The Boeing BGS Program Protection Team is seeking a Product Security Engineer to serve as a technical member of a team of Platform Product Security Engineers.  This team is active in shaping product security requirements with industry and government partners - anticipating needs, and integrating best-in-industry solutions.

This position is expected to be 100% on-site at the Fort Greely, AK location.

Position Responsibilities:

  • With the focus on Platform Cyber Security, this position will serve as a team member supporting analysis of requirements, risk management, and information systems. As such, this is an engineering role.

  • Develops, implements, and sustains product security and resiliency throughout the requirements, design, build, test, production, operations, and support lifecycle.

  • Develops and enhances system requirements and architectures for product security to meet all applicable certification and customer requirements.

  • Ensures security of facilities, equipment, tools, data, networks, and resources used for product: design, development, build, test, storage, delivery, operations, and support.

  • Defines and identifies product security requirements for suppliers of components and subsystems for integration into Boeing products and services.

  • Coordinates with governments, customers, suppliers, and industry to identify risks and improve industry and regulatory security standards and requirements for programs and interfacing systems.

  • Conducts research and development activities resulting in innovative solutions.

  • Advises customers on maintaining product security and certification, including security consequences of modifying products and services.

This position requires an active Secret U.S. Security Clearance.  (A U.S. Security Clearance that has been active in the past 24 months is considered active.)

Basic Qualifications (Required Skills/Experience):

  • Current DoD 8140.03 Personnel Certification intermediate level certification such as GFACT, CySA+, SSCP, Security+, or GSEC.

  • 3 or more years’ experience with industry standard cybersecurity frameworks (NIST, OWASP).

  • 5+ years of experience working in at least one engineering field for large or small-scale systems

  • A technical background working with Information Technology in a Weapon System context.

  • Bachelor of Science degree from an accredited course of study in engineering, engineering technology (includes manufacturing engineering technology) chemistry, physics, mathematics, data science, or computer science.

Preferred Qualifications

  • CISSP or equivalent certification

  • Knowledge of DoD policies and requirements related to Cyber Security

  • 5+ years of experience in the field of cyber security, anti-tamper and/or secure computing

  • 5+ years of experience in working with suppliers, developing statement-of-work and technical performance specifications

  • Understanding DoD contracting, developing proposals, and the Boeing estimating process
